			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<section class="sp-section sp-scheme-0" data-index="8" data-scheme="0"><div class="sp-section-slide"  data-label="Main" ><div class="sp-section-content" ><div class="sp-grid sp-col sp-col-24"><div class="sp-block sp-heading-block " data-type="heading" data-id="0" style="text-align:start;"><div class="sp-block-content"  style=""><span class='h2' ><h2 >This Sunday and beyond...</h2></span></div></div><div class="sp-block sp-text-block " data-type="text" data-id="1" style=""><div class="sp-block-content"  style=""><b>Eternal Church!</b><br>I am excited to take our first step together this Sunday as we grow in Christ through the Word of God being sung, prayed, read, and preached. This week we’ll begin by taking the next four weeks to remember why we exist. We’ll look at how the coordinates of Truth, Worship, Community, and Witness are meant to reorient and remind us of the purpose that’s been breathed into each of us by the God of Creation.<br><br>As we begin, I’d love to pass along some helpful ways to prepare for our time together.<br>Dr. Gunner Gundersen wrote a brief booklet entitled: How Do I Get the Most from My Pastor’s Sermons? In it, he discusses seven tips for hearing well:<ol><li>Read the passage beforehand</li><li>Pray for your pastor</li><li>Remember who’s speaking</li><li>Furrow the field (till the soil)</li><li>Arrive early</li><li>Soak in the experience</li><li>Trust and obey</li></ol><br>You can read a brief explanation of each of these things here:<br><a href="https://www.crossway.org/articles/7-tips-for-getting-more-out-of-sunday-sermons/?utm_source=Crossway+Marketing&amp;utm_campaign=f576a123ca-20260717+Demo-7TipsforGettingMoreoutofSundaySer&amp;utm_medium=email&amp;utm_term=0_-929f64a769-294939109&amp;mc_cid=f576a123ca&amp;mc_eid=89f31270fd" rel="noopener noreferrer" target="_blank"><b>7 Tips for Getting More out of Sunday Sermons</b></a><b>&nbsp;</b><br><br>With that, you can begin to prepare your heart for our time together by reading Genesis 1:1 and asking yourself, do I believe that in the beginning God created all things?<br>And if so, what are the implications for my life today?<br><br>I am wonderfully excited to jump into the Word this Sunday with each of you.
